WORKING CONDITIONS: 

The Machine Shop CNC will primarily work in a plant setting which is a smoke free environment that has typical factory hazards including noise, dust, cutting, drilling, finishing, solvents, lubricants, slipping and tripping hazards, blocked walkways, and hazards common to machining of parts such as sharp tools and objects, moving parts, metal shavings and slivers, unfinished surfaces, flames, sparks, cutting fluids, hydraulic oils and smoke.  United Equipment Accessories, Inc. functions in a real market environment that changes at various times of the year which occasionally may create high output or greater time pressure demands.

ESSENTIAL DUTIES, RESPONSIBILITIES, AND MEASUREMENTS OF PERFORMANCE: 

CNC MACHINING/PROGRAMMING - 

  • Regulate machine functions including reference planes, surface locations, speed, feed, depth & angle  
  • Select, align, and change machine tooling and attachment accessories 
  • Coordinate with CNC programmer to proof our prototype parts.  
  • Optimize CNC programs to meet quality standards & increase efficiency while reducing cycle times
